I used to be that commodities were understood to be the ultimate business cyclical sector - when economy was strong commodities were up very strongly, and vice versa. And clearly this is still the case - the bullish case for commodities was always based on the 12% growth in China and India. So the negative correlation of commodities to stocks is a bogus notion - except in case of serious geopolitical instability where you'd expect gold and oil to shoot up. So, to believe that as the end-of-the-world is approaching and be buying commodities is sheer stupidity - because by definition end-of-the-world really means a serious recession in china.
